2025-04-117:14 am Re: Video tutorial?? using multi midi channel virtual instr Post by dathyr1 » Thu Jan 23, 2014 10:57 am Hi bbdrmz,Nice idea to try and tried it, but all that does is allow us to do is layer vsti plugin sounds. One Plugin does not play the others or be able to wrap around to a 2nd one. Acoustica needs to add midi bus control sometime in the future like Reaper or FL studio. They have come along way with Mixcraft.Still playing around with Arp though. take care,Dave Mark Bliss Posts: 7320 Joined: Fri Jan 20, 2012 3:59 pm Location: Out there Re: Video tutorial?? using multi midi channel virtual instr Post by Mark Bliss » Thu Jan 23, 2014 11:31 am As has been said, there is currently no way to send midi data between VSTi's in Mixcraft, the only workaround I can imagine for now is to create that particular arpeggiated synth sound in an outside program, such as the other DAW you mentioned, then import that sound and work on the rest of the layers in Mixcraft. Perhaps in the future the feature you MIDI geeks desire will be added. dathyr1 Posts: 139 Joined: Tue Jun 07, 2011 7:14 am Re: Video tutorial?? using multi midi channel virtual instr Post by dathyr1 » Thu Jan 23, 2014 12:10 pm Hi Greg and all,I use Kontakt allot and it has many many arpeggiated and sequenced snd libraries which I use.
